PM Swamitva Scheme Guidelines - Summary
Recently, Prime Minister Narendra Modi introduced the PM Swamitva Scheme (स्वामित्व योजना) 2023-24, an innovative initiative aimed at providing a property validation solution for rural India. The PM Swamitva Yojana is designed to help rural residents secure loans on their village properties, overcoming challenges that have long hindered access to financial services in these areas.
Without an online application or registration form yet available, the PM Swamitva Scheme promises to empower individuals living in rural areas by allowing them to leverage their properties for loans from banks.
The 2023-24 version of the PM Swamitva Yojana plans to demarcate inhabited land in rural regions using advanced surveying techniques. The central government will employ drone technology in collaboration with various departments, such as the Ministry of Panchayati Raj and State Revenue Departments, as well as the Survey of India, to achieve this goal.
